Common Guitar Gelato Problems faced by Guitarists
1) There are times when you do not know the correct training methodology that you need to adopt in order to improve your guitar playing skills. There are many guitar legato exercises available online or in guide books. Following all of them is almost impossible. Unless and until you are told which exercises to practice first before proceeding to the next set of exercises, you shall never be able to develop your gelato skills.
2) When you are doing licks and you are performing hammer on’s and pull offs, your hands tend to get tired. This fatigue is owing to the incorrect technique that these guitarists are habitual of implementing while playing this instrument. In order to resolve this issue, they would need to adopt corrective techniques.
3) There are times when you tend to perform hammer ons much easier that pull offs. This happens when your knowledge on the correct implementation on pull offs is very less. At the same time, you also tend to play songs that make use of hammer ons much more than pull offs.
4) At times, you tend to stop improving. This is also known as hitting a plateau. This is when you need to implement correct techniques in order to improve your skills and improve your guitar playing abilities. Plateaus like this can only be broken when you use corrective techniques.
5) There are times when you tend to get rather stiff while performing guitar legatos. This is a very painful affair for your fingers. To get rid of this issue, you need to start improving your techniques considerably.
6) While there are truck-loads of eBook, videos and illustrations available worldwide hat encourage you to improve guitar legatos, there is no book that teaches you how to do so. They just tell you that you need to improve, without mentioning the technique for achieving this goal. This would certainly block your progress.
7) You may find it rather tough to use your smaller fingers for performing hammer ons and pull-offs. On the contrary, you may be able to perform these exercises rather well using your first to fingers (first and the index). This would certainly hamper your overall progress and stop you from becoming a master of this instrument.
